Nigel Seton Avery (born 31 August 1967) is a former weightlifting competitor for New Zealand. He was born in Auckland.

At the 1998 Commonwealth Games in Kuala Lumpur he won a bronze medal in the 105+ kg snatch and the 105+ kg combined total.

He went to the 2002 Commonwealth Games in Manchester where he 2 gold medals in the 105+ kg clean and jerk and 105+ kg combined total, and gained a silver medal in the 105+ kg snatch. He was the Closing Ceremony flag bearer for New Zealand.

He competed at the 2000 Olympic Games in Sydney placing 17th in the 105+ kg men.

From 1991 - 1996 he was a member of the New Zealand Bobsleigh team.[1]

He has appeared on the TV One program Downsize Me! to show the effect of a high-fat diet on a very fit person.[2]
